25 Cheap Meals to Make When You Are Broke

In times of financial strain, finding ways to eat well on a budget becomes essential. Fortunately, with a bit of creativity and planning, you can enjoy delicious and satisfying meals without breaking the bank. Here are 25 affordable meal ideas that are both economical and nourishing:

1. Spaghetti Aglio e Olio
Simple yet flavorful with garlic, olive oil, and red pepper flakes.

2. Rice and Beans
A classic combination that's hearty and protein-packed.

3. Vegetable Stir-Fry
Use affordable seasonal vegetables with soy sauce and rice for a
filling meal.

4. Egg Fried Rice
Utilize leftover rice and eggs with soy sauce and frozen veggies.

5. Tomato Soup with Grilled Cheese
Comforting and easy to make with canned tomatoes and cheese.

6. Tuna Salad
Mix canned tuna with mayo, celery, and spices for sandwiches or wraps.

7. Pasta with Marinara Sauce
Basic pasta with a store-bought or homemade tomato sauce.

8. Bean Chili
Make a big batch with beans, tomatoes, and spices, served with rice or cornbread.

9. Potato and Egg Hash
Fry potatoes with onions and top with fried or scrambled eggs.

Tips for Budget-Friendly Cooking:

Buy in Bulk: Purchase staples like rice, beans, and pasta in bulk for cost savings.
Use Frozen and Canned Foods: These are often cheaper and can be just as nutritious.
Plan Ahead: Meal planning helps you make the most of ingredients and avoid waste.
Cook in Batches: Prepare larger portions and freeze leftovers for future meals.
Shop Sales and Discounts: Take advantage of weekly specials and coupons
